The U.S. Produced Water Treatment Market: Growth Insights

In recent years, the U.S. produced water treatment market has gained significant momentum, reflecting a growing understanding of the importance of efficient water management practices. The market value, once at US$ 2,848.70 million, is set to expand dramatically, with expectations to reach a staggering US$ 5,118.19 million in the foreseeable future. This impressive growth translates into a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 6.85%, highlighting the urgent demand for advanced treatment technologies and infrastructure.

Challenges and Drivers: Understanding the Market Landscape

The sheer volume of water produced alongside oil and gas extraction presents a complex set of challenges for operators across the nation. For instance, in just one sector, the Permian Basin, leading companies have been producing upwards of 20 million barrels of water daily. This immense scale emphasizes the inherent need for robust treatment facilities and technological advancements.

Additionally, trends from other key regions exhibit a similar reliance on produced water management. Notably, the Bakken region has seen produced water volumes nearly double since 2019, which further underlines the need for sophisticated recycling initiatives and treatment strategies. As operators seek to mitigate costs while adhering to stricter environmental regulations, the demand for innovative water treatment solutions continues to rise.

Key Findings from the Market

Recent analysis reveals several noteworthy points regarding the U.S. produced water treatment market:

  • The projected market value by 2033 is US$ 5,118.19 million.
  • Physical treatment methods are the most widely adopted, accounting for 47.70% of market usage.
  • Oil & gas field operations dominate water usage at 67.14%.
  • Onshore applications are prevalent, comprising approximately 83.32% of the market.
  • Unconventional sources account for 78.75% of produced water.

Regulatory Environment: Stricter Standards Ahead

Growing awareness of environmental concerns, particularly regarding seismic activity linked to saltwater disposal, has resulted in stricter regulatory measures. States are responding rapidly to incidents, imposing new operational constraints that significantly affect produced water treatment practices. For instance, the Texas Railroad Commission has expanded the review radius for new disposal wells, thus intensifying the scrutiny of water management protocols.

These developments underscore the importance of adopting innovative water treatment technologies that not only comply with current regulations but also address community concerns regarding environmental impacts.
